If three times the larger of two numbers is divided by the smaller we get 4 as quotient and 8 as reminder. If five times the smaller is divi
ded by the larger we get 3 as quotientand 5 as remainder. Find the numbers

Note:  We know that Dividend = Divisor * Quotient + Remainder. 

Let the larger number be x and the smaller number be y.

Given that 3 times, the larger number is divided by smaller we get 4 as Quotient and 8 as remainder.

= > 3x = y * 4 + 8

= > 3x = 4y + 8

= > 3x - 4y = 8   --------- (1)


Given that if five times the smaller is divided by larger we get 3 as Quotient and 5 as remainder.

= > 5y = 3x + 5

= > 5y - 3x = 5   

= > -3x + 5y = 5  --------- (2)


On solving (1) & (2), we get

= >  3x - 4y = 8

= > -3x + 5y = 5

     --------------------

              y = 13


Substitute y = 13 in (1), we get

= > 3x - 4y = 8

= > 3x - 4(13) = 8

= > 3x - 52 = 8

= > 3x = 52 + 8

= > 3x = 60

= > x = 60/3

= > x = 20.

Therefore the numbers are 20, 13.


Verification:

= > 3 * x = 4 * y + 8

= > 3(20) = 4 * 13 + 8

= > 60 = 52 + 8

= > 60 = 60.
